**About the Company** Founded in 2015, Rapido is India’s leading multi-modal mobility platform. What began with bike taxis has rapidly evolved to include auto-rickshaws, cab-hailing, and peer-to-peer deliveries. Today, Rapido commands a dominant 70% market share in bike taxis, 40% in auto rides, and holds the second-largest position in the cab segment with a 22% share—establishing us as the overall market leader in ride-hailing. With over 4 million rides completed daily and more than 2 billion rides served to date, Rapido operates in 200+ cities and is aggressively expanding toward a presence in 500 cities. In 2024, we proudly achieved unicorn status with a valuation of $1.1 billion.
